10 reviews on Google“Geer Nursing and Rehabilitation receives highly polarized feedback, with some families praising the rehab therapy team for successful post-surgery recovery, while others report severe neglect and communication failures. Critical reviews highlight alarming instances of residents being left unmonitored, poor hygiene, and a lack of notification regarding medical emergencies. Potential families should be aware of the significant disparity between the positive rehab experiences and the negative reports regarding long-term nursing care.”

Families filed complaints that led to findings of abuse and neglect concerns, which should prompt careful evaluation. The facility shows recurring issues with care planning, treatment delivery, and pressure ulcer care across multiple years from 2019 to 2024. While all deficiencies have reported correction dates, the pattern of repeated problems in core care areas suggests ongoing challenges with maintaining consistent quality standards.
